Biological Activity
Description
In Vitro
PROTACs contain two different ligands connected by a linker; one is a ligand for an E807 ubiquitin ligase and the other is for the target protein. PROTACs exploit the intracellular ubiquitin-proteasome system to selectively degrade target proteins.
